完全二叉树和满二叉树的区别如下:
1、完全二叉树是深度为k,有n个结点的二叉树,当且仅当其每一个结点,都与深度为k的满二叉树中编号从1至n的结点逐一对应的二叉树;
2、完全二叉树的叶子结点只可能在层次最大的两层上出现;
3、对任一结点,若其右分支下子孙的最大层次为l,则其左分支下子孙的最大层次必为l或者I加1;
3、满二叉树是一棵深度为k,且有2的k次方减1个节点的二叉树;
4、满二叉树的每一层上的结点数都是最大结点数。
完全二叉树和满二叉树的区别
最新推荐文章于 2024-07-23 20:38:48 发布
本文详细介绍了完全二叉树和满二叉树的区别,包括它们的定义、结构特点以及在实际应用中的差异。完全二叉树的叶子节点只出现在最上两层,并且每个节点与满二叉树中对应编号的节点一致。满二叉树则是每一层都拥有最大数量的节点。理解这些概念对于深入学习二叉树数据结构至关重要。
摘要由CSDN通过智能技术生成